Common room was wonderful, met a lot of really interesting folks visiting the Fukuoka! Walk-in/step-in showers and bathrooms are outside of sleeping rooms, but private which was a pleasant surprise (only one person at a time!) Love that there's a curfew (12am which is more than reasonable imo) Location is conveniently near the Gion station on the Fukuoka Airport Line and a few minutes walk to Kushida Shrine and Kawabata Shopping Arcade which made it super convenient for food, sight-seeing, and shopping!
The rooms are a little tight, but manageable! For those looking for something more accessible, this hostel requires you to climb stairs to reach your room.

Beautiful little place. -The hosts were just lovely. It has everything you need, kitchen and sitting area. -Dorm beds are comfy and even better, don’t squeak or move when the person in the other bunk moves. There’s a small sitting area in the 4-bed dorm. - It’s an easy 10 minute walk from Hakata station. - 5 min walk to Gion subway station - no real noise in the area at night - lots of lovely artwork and arrangement in the various nooks and crannies - washer and dryer (¥200 per load, 4.5kg) - very close to Canal City, Riverain Mall, Kawabata shopping street (all a 5 min walk)

Second stay at guest house, just as pleasant | nice location, close to shopping arcade and Hakata Old Town | very clean | small but effective kitchen, coffee/tea provided | solid WiFi, nice common area | warm shower, soap/shampoo provided | inexpensive washer dryer, greatly appreciated | lockers available, beds have privacy curtains | thank you
